Saraki Appoints Sacked Senator As Personal Aide
Abubakar Danladi has just been announced as the new Special Adviser on Special Duties to the Senate President, Bukola Saraki.
The appointment was announced through a statement by the Special Adviser, Media and Publicity to the Senate President, Yusuph Olaniyonu, on Sunday.
The appointment takes immediate
effect, the statement noted.
Recall that, Mr Danladi was sacked in 2017 by the Supreme Court as senator
representing Taraba North.
In a unanimous judgement, the
court nullified Mr. Danladi’s
election and declared his challenger, Shuaibu Lau, the winner of the 2014 primary election of the Peoples Democratic Party in the Taraba North
Senatorial District.
The court also asked Mr Lau to return all the salaries and allowances he received as senator.
